#716E00 Hex Color Code

#716E00

The Hexadecimal Color #716E00 is a contrast shade of Olive. #716E00 RGB value is rgb(113, 110, 0). RGB Color Model of #716E00 consists of 44% red, 43% green and 0% blue. HSL color Mode of #716E00 has 58°(degrees) Hue, 100% Saturation and 22% Lightness. #716E00 color has an wavelength of 583.48148nm approximately. The nearest Web Safe Color of #716E00 is #999933. The Closest Small Hexadecimal Code of #716E00 is #760. The Closest Color to #716E00 is #808000. Official Name of #716E00 Hex Code is Yukon Gold. CMYK (Cyan Magenta Yellow Black) of #716E00 is 0 Cyan 3 Magenta 100 Yellow 56 Black and #716E00 CMY is 0, 3, 100. HSLA (Hue Saturation Lightness Alpha) of #716E00 is hsl(58,100,22, 1.0) and HSV is hsv(58, 100, 44). A Three-Dimensional XYZ value of #716E00 is 12.39, 14.66, 2.18.
Hex8 Value of #716E00 is #716E00FF. Decimal Value of #716E00 is 7433728 and Octal Value of #716E00 is 34267000. Binary Value of #716E00 is 1110001, 1101110, 0 and Android of #716E00 is 4285623808 / 0xff716e00. The Horseshoe Shaped Chromaticity Diagram xyY of #716E00 is 0.424, 0.502, 0.502 and YIQ Color Space of #716E00 is 98.357, 37.1307, -33.5975. The Color Space LMS (Long Medium Short) of #716E00 is 15.02, 16.18, 2.38. CieLAB (L*a*b*) of #716E00 is 45.16, -10.12, 51.15. CieLUV : LCHuv (L*, u*, v*) of #716E00 is 45.16, 5.68, 49.37. The cylindrical version of CieLUV is known as CieLCH : LCHab of #716E00 is 45.16, 52.14, 101.19. Hunter Lab variable of #716E00 is 38.29, -9.24, 23.43.

Analogous and Monochromatic Colors of #716E00

Analogous colors are groups of hues that are located next to each other on the color wheel. These colors share a similar undertone and create a sense of harmony when used together. Analogous color schemes are mainly used in design or art to create a sense of cohesion and flow in a color scheme composition.

Monochromatic colors refer to a color scheme that uses variations of a single color. These variations are achieved by adjusting the shade, tint, or tone of the base color. Monochromatic approach is commonly used in interior design or fashion to create a sense of understated elegance and give a sense of simplicity and consistency.

Triad, Tetrad and SplitComplement of #716E00

Triad, Tetrad, and Split Complement are hex color schemes used in art to create harmonious combinations of colors.

The Triad color scheme involves three colors that are evenly spaced around the color wheel, forming an equilateral triangle. The primary triad includes red, blue, and yellow, while other triadic combinations can be formed with different hues. Triad color schemes offer a balanced contrast and are versatile for creating vibrant and dynamic visuals.

The Tetrad color scheme incorporates four colors that are arranged in two complementary pairs. These pairs create a rectangle or square shape on the color wheel. The primary Tetrad includes two sets of complementary colors, such as red and green, and blue and orange. This scheme provides a wide range of color options and allows for both strong contrast and harmonious blends.

The Split Complement color scheme involves a base color paired with the two colors adjacent to its complementary color on the color wheel. For example, if the base color is blue, the Split Complement scheme would include blue, yellow-orange, and red-orange. This combination maintains contrast while offering a more subtle and balanced alternative to a complementary color scheme.
